According to the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(@AHRQNews) “Patient experience encompasses the range of interactions that patients have with the health care system, including their care from health plans, and from doctors, nurses, and staff in hospitals, physician practices, and other health care facilities.” How can understanding patient experience improve and advance patient-centered care? What aspects of health care delivery fall under the umbrella of patient experience? We will explore answers to these questions and all of the ins and outs of patient experience in this series.

Patients Want Private Rooms, and Hospitals are Accommodating Them
Mass. General is joining other medical centers across the country in building new private rooms to give patients and caregivers more space and privacy. Mass. General is seeking approval to build two connected towers with 450 spacious private rooms, at a cost of more than $1 billion. Across the city, Beth Israel Deaconess Medical Center is constructing 158 new single rooms, while Boston Children’s Hospital plans to convert all of its doubles into private rooms in the coming years. These projects reflect a growing sentiment that patient comfort is becoming an essential part of the hospital business.

Iron Mountain VA Medical Center wins National Best Patient Experience Award
According to The Mining Journal, the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s Veterans Health Administration recently recognized the Oscar G. Johnson VA Medical Center for providing its patients with outstanding health care experiences. The Iron Mountain-based VA Medical Center received the 2018 Best Experience Award for Level 3 (small, low complexity) facilities at the Veterans Patient Experience Symposium Feb 5-7 in Washington, D.C., according to a press release.
